Key Responsibilities
* Deliver clean linen in covered carts to designated hospital areas
* Collect soiled linen in covered carts and transport it to designated locations
* Verify and document linen quantities accurately
* Conduct linen inventory as required
* Resolve basic client issues and escalate concerns as needed
* Communicate linen quality or delivery concerns to supervisors
* Build strong customer relationships and provide ongoing support
*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work environment
* Follow hospital and company procedures and safety guidelines
* Operate laundry equipment as needed
* Perform clerical tasks (e.g., answering phones, data entry)
* Adhere to Joint Commission standards
* Perform other duties as assigned
